Jan 29, 2014The growth would depend on the number of clients connecting, and what kind of persistence is used. It's not just a matter of number of clients, as many clients could share the criterion for persistence (e.g. IP-address).
I would start by looking at the size of your current persistence table. However, before that you may want to determine whether it even makes sense to extend it to such a long time, especially if the persistence would exceed the session timeout on the servers. In that case I'd question whether anything can be gained.
